Abstract

Introduction: Child maltreatment is characterized as all forms of physical or psychological harm, sexual abuse, neglect or negligent treatment, commercial or other exploitation, resulting in actual or potential harm to the child's health, survival, development, or dignity in the context of a relationship of responsibility, trust, or power (WHO & International Society for Prevention of Child Abuse and Neglect, 2006, p.9).

The 2020 annual report on statistics from the Portuguese Association for Victim Support (APAV) reports that the average number of child victims of abuse in Portugal is 1,841 per year. Therefore, it is essential for nurses to intervene in detecting, referring, and intervening in cases of children at risk.

Objective: Identify the nursing interventions in the detection and reporting of child maltreatment in hospitalized children.

Methods: An integrative literature review was conducted, according to Whittemore & Knafl (2005), involving a search in CINAHL and MEDLINE databases, with an application of inclusion and exclusion criteria.

Results: Nursing interventions in the detection and reporting of child abuse are multifaceted, ranging from initial suspicion and detection to formal notification and appropriate referral.

Conclusion: With the implementation of strategies to detect and report suspected cases of child abuse, there is an increase in the number of children referred to organizations that promote the protection and rights of children, enhancing early detection that promotes child well-being and development.
